Output 626e0177663280ae33dcb08ee598594019410107b82ed0bd4753b37389029685:0

value
217000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16b64864dda62bbe1f3cecdfee622097540cafaa OP_EQUALVERIFY OP_CHECKSIG
address
1356ET8TKdgePJusETfjLzM4Bw7BZNfRkK
transaction
626e0177663280ae33dcb08ee598594019410107b82ed0bd4753b37389029685
confirmations
537701
spent
true